Kleo Patent Contrast Cap-Toe Pumps, Silver, hi-res
Kleo Patent Contrast Cap-Toe Pumps
HK$399.00

Kleo Patent Contrast Cap-Toe Pumps - Silver

HK$399.00

(Includes Duties & Taxes)

Express Checkout

Editor's Picks